USER GUIDE Quantum SuperTrend AI Alerts MT5 1. Purpose Quantum SuperTrend AI Alerts MT5 is a notification indicator and on-chart dashboard for MetaTrader 5. The indicator does not generate its own trading signals. It works together with the main Quantum SuperTrend AI indicator, reads its signals via iCustom(), and sends notifications when entry or exit signals appear. Push Notification Setup To receive push notifications on your phone: 1) Install the MetaTrader 5 mobile app. 2) Open the mobile app. 3) Find your MetaQuotes ID. 4) In desktop MetaTrader 5, open Tools → Options → Notifications. 5) Enable Push Notifications. 6) Enter your MetaQuotes ID. 7) Click Test. 8) In the indicator settings, set InpUsePushNotification = true. 8. Moving the Dashboard The dashboard can be moved around the chart. To move it, hold the top header area where the indicator name is displayed and drag the panel to the desired location. While the dashboard is being moved, chart movement is temporarily locked. After the mouse button is released, chart movement is restored automatically. The parameter: InpLockChartDragForPanel = true is recommended to remain enabled. 10.
